| Stewart Talent | |
![]() |
Challenge: Redesign a talent agency's web site, give visitors different types of dynamic content for each of the agency's departments (voiceover, on-camera/theatrical, and print), and create a content management system that is simple to use and flexible for expansion. Solution: A proprietary MySQL/PHP-driven site provides each department with unique content management tools based on their specific client's needs, including an automatic PDF creation tool that merges two uploaded images into a single downloadable PDF of a headshot/resume. Additional functionality is built into the backend to generate uniquely-tailored talent lists for casting directors. |
